Deadly Dees hit Vipers for six

Vipers 18 Dunstablians 41

Dunstablians continued their impressive start to Midlands Two East South as they secured a bonus-point win with a six try haul at Vipers on Saturday.

Duncan Holmes and Jake Hobbs both went over in the first half with Joe Murphy converting and adding a penalty as Dees lead 17-15.

The visitors ran away with the result in the second period as Stuart Hall, Hobbs, Stuart Calder and Danny Mills touched down, with Murphy’s boot doing the rest.

This weekend, Dees travel to table-topping Huntingdon & District.
